Has anyone else had any unsubscribes when preview and testing an email, using a live record, with "Enabled System Generated Links" checked and sent to Outlook for Mac?
We are completing the following steps and are seeing an unsubscribe happen when we open the email in Outlook for Mac:
1. Check that the record is an active subscriber
2. Send a test email using preview and test of that active record (ensuring "Enabled System Generated Links" is checked)
3. Open test email in Outlook for Mac
4. Record associated with test is unsubscribed.
The unsubscribe reason is listed as "unsubscribed from Subscription Center"; however, we do not have one-click unsubscribe in our emails. The user must click through to our preference center and fill out a short survey prior to unsubscribing. I am not seeing how an open in Outlook for Mac would trigger an unsubscribe.

I am not clicking an unsubscribe in the email or the application. However, after some extensive testing, we actually found that we had a system default text footer, which seems to be causing the issue.
We're still not sure why, because we are getting the HTML version and the only time the unsubscribe happens is when we preview and test (not in an actual send), but we suspect that it is a company/internal system setting that is clicking the one-click unsub from the text version system default footer. As a workaround, we have turned that off, as it isn't needed anyway.
